Abstract

本发明涉及一种骨科手术用导向机构,具有准直管和导向管;所述准直管套接在导向管外侧;所述导向管由依次连接的第一直行部、弯曲部和第二直行部组成。本发明结构简单,性能可靠,可使脊柱手术从单侧入路后可对对侧进行处理,降低了手术难度,减少了手术时间,降低了患者痛苦。

Description

骨科手术用导向机构
技术领域
本发明涉及医疗器械制造技术领域,特别涉及一种骨科手术用导向机构。
背景技术
骨科手术特别是脊柱手术,常需要从一侧入路处理对侧椎体或椎间隙,如行TLIF手术时,为了能够从单侧入路处理对侧椎间隙。现行的方法是先使用直形工具处理同侧间隙,再使用弯头工具处理对侧间隙;再如行椎体后凸成形术时,为了实现对整个椎体进行复位和填充骨水泥,现行的方法是从两侧椎弓根分别穿刺后进行复位和填充骨水泥。无论是使用直形、弯头工具处理椎间隙,还是双侧椎弓根穿刺对椎体复位和填充骨水泥,都延长了手术时间,增加手术难度,增加患者痛苦。
发明内容
本发明的目的是克服现有技术存在的缺陷,提供一种结构简单,性能可靠,可使脊柱手术从单侧入路后可对对侧进行处理,降低手术难度,减少手术时间,降低患者痛苦的骨科手术用导向机构。
实现本发明目的的技术方案是:一种骨科手术用导向机构,具有准直管和导向管;所述准直管套接在导向管外侧;所述导向管由依次连接的第一直行部、弯曲部和第二直行部组成。
上述技术方案所述导向管的为超弹性态的镍钛合金导向管。
上述技术方案所述镍钛合金导向管的奥氏体转变终了温度Af为5-15℃。
采用上述技术方案后,本发明具有以下积极的效果:
本发明结构简单,性能可靠,可使脊柱手术从单侧入路后可对对侧进行处理,降低了手术难度,减少了手术时间,降低了患者痛苦。

具体实施方式
(实施例1)
见图1至图4,本发明具有准直管1和导向管2;准直管1套接在导向管2外侧;导向管2由依次连接的第一直行部21、弯曲部22和第二直行部23组成。
导向管2内设有柔性芯3;柔性芯3的右侧端部连接刚性杆4的左端;刚性杆4的右端通过卡接在导向管2右端的凸凹部件5与球钻6相连。导向管2为镍钛记忆合金导向管。
(实施例2)
见图5,本发明具有准直管1和导向管2;准直管1套接在导向管2外侧;导向管2由依次连接的第一直行部21、弯曲部22和第二直行部23组成。
导向管2的弯曲部22和第二直行部23位置具有若干侧向孔7,第二直行部23的右端部开设有端部孔8。导向管2为镍钛记忆合金导向管。

Claims (3)

1.一种骨科手术用导向机构,具有准直管(1)和导向管(2);所述准直管(1)套接在导向管(2)外侧;其特征在于:所述导向管(2)在室温自由状态下由依次连接的第一直行部(21)、弯曲部(22)和第二直行部(23)组成。
2.根据权利要求1所述的骨科手术用导向机构,其特征在于:所述导向管(2)的为超弹性态的镍钛合金导向管。
3.根据权利要求2所述的骨科手术用导向机构,其特征在于:所述镍钛合金导向管的奥氏体转变终了温度Af为5-15℃。
